Bayview Construction Named Signature Sponsor of The Big Tournament

Bayview Construction will once again be the Signature Sponsor for The Big Tournament,
benefitting Big Brothers Big Sisters of Palm Beach and Martin Counties (BBBS). The Big Tournament will be hosted by The Evergreen Club in Palm City on March 20, 2012 and is presented in conjunction with The Big Taste, sponsored by Fox, Wackeen, Dungey, Beard, Sobel, Bush & McCluskey LLP and hosted by Honorary Chair Bernard Carmouche, Culinary Director for Emeril's Restaurants. Bayview Construction has supported The Big Taste for the past three years and is very dedicated to Big Brothers Big Sisters and the children they serve.

About Big Brothers Big Sisters of Palm Beach and Martin Counties

BBBS provides children facing adversity aged 6-17 with volunteer mentors who serve as positive role models. Since 1986 the organization has provided mentors to children in Martin County and since July 2010 in Palm Beach County. Big Brothers Big Sisters of America (BBBSA) recognized the Martin County organization in 2007 as one of the 35 best performing agencies nationwide. BBBSA recognized CEO William P. Bee Jr. as "CEO of the Year- Small Agency Category" in 2007. South Florida Business Leader Magazine ranked BBBS in 2009 and again in 2010 as one of the top 100 South Florida small businesses.
